
What is a kigurumi animal costume?
Kigurumi is a Japanese phrase, meaning 'a stuffed toy that you wear'. Which says alot about what a kigurumi costume is already.
Many kigurumi outfits represent animals, always with a cartoony or stuffed toy look about them. Other kigurumi outfits represent cartoon characters, both popular and make-believe.
The phrase encompasses great big outfits padded to give an unhuman shape - such as the performers/actors you might expect to see wondering about in Disney Land and also much smaller scale costumes. The smaller scale outfits are sometimes known as 'disguise pyjamas' or 'animal pyjamas' . These are light-weight all-in-one jumpsuits, with a hood to give the wearer a new identity. As long as a costume looks cartoony or stuffed-toy like, it pretty much counts.
In Japan, kigurumi animal pyjamas have become fashionable streetwear, and it is not unusual to see the latest manga characters or a tiger walking down the streets of Tokyo late at night. Or early in the morning come to think of it. These costumed idivduals are known as 'kigurumin'.
In the west a similar craze exists, known as fursuits, furplay or furries. Although this has yet to venture out from close-knit conventions and private parties into the realms of street wear, largely due to the prevalance of the Disney-style padded costumes. Difficult to negotiate narrow doorways, you might imagine.
However, the lighter wight kigurumi animal pyjamas have started toemerge in the West in 2010. Lilly Allen famously sported a Dinosaur at Bestival in 2009.
